Municipal Power in the City of St. George
The municipal power concept began in St. George in March of 1909 with a small hydro generation system powered by water from the open ditch of the Cottonwood Canal at the base of Pine Valley Mountain.
Millcreek Generation Facility
The Millcreek Generation Facility (MGF) is a 40 MW natural gas fired facility. Construction on the MGF began in May of 2005 and was completed a year later.
Red Rock Generation Facility
The Red Rock Generation Facility is located at 695 E. Red Hills Pkwy and is owned and operated by the City of St. George Energy Services Department (SGESD).
Bloomington Generation Facility
This plant is located in the southwest corner of Bloomington, adjacent to the Regional Wastewater Treatment Plant.
Gunlock Hydro Plant
The Gunlock Hydro Plant was put in service in 1987 and is located 15 miles West of St. George, 200 yards down stream from Gunlock Reservoir.
Pine Valley Hydro Plant
The The Pine Valley Hydro Plant was originally constructed in 1941 and provided power to St. George until 1981.
